should I use Omega3 after PTCA

My wife was under treatment Under SPGIMS,Lucknow where Agioplasty was done in two Artery and in one artery is block till now .and doctor has advised for PTCA in 3rd artery on 15thapril13.May In use Omega-3 to her without any consultancy.

Be aware that OMEGA-3 has anti agregants effects, therefore I would not use it one week before of any intervention.

In the other hand, there are studies that show better recovery if high dose of Q10 has been used before the cardiac intervention.

However, going into the operation theater, I would not take anything without previously discuss it with the doctor.

There are rumours of many things in diets which are supposed to help, but lack the actual evidence. Some research has shown slight benefits with omega, while others have shown increase in disease. The ideas come from simple basic thinking. For example, with omega they wondered how eskimos could eat fat and be heart disease free, so they looked at the content of fish meat which they eat lots of. Of course, this showed up Omega oils so they ASSUMED it must be this. I have read that most people in developed countries lack both vitamin C and E, so taking these supplements are now supposed to help. However, vitamin E is a fat soluble vitamin, so it must be the jelly type capsules which also contain a drop of fat. I read a report a short while ago where a Doctor believed a vitamin in Carrots helps reduce lung cancer. He took subjects, gave them supplements and lung cancer increased, which shocked everyone. So I take what I read about with a pinch of salt. If blood tests reveal you are lacking something, then obviously take supplements. There is nothing better than a 'balanced healthy diet' to get everything you need. Oily fish and many types of nuts contain Omega.
